Common Water Line Problems: What to Be Aware Of
Which indicators point to a potential water line issue? Homeowners should be vigilant for several key indicators. A particularly noticeable indicator is a sudden jump in water bills, which could indicate a concealed leak. Moreover, unaccounted for moisture spots or water pools in landscaped areas or lower levels often point to a failing line. Variations in water pressure, including a marked reduction or unstable flow, typically signal possible problems. Foul smells or tainted water might point to pollution or internal corrosion. Moreover, audible signs like running water or bubbling in plumbing fixtures and drainage systems could suggest leaks. Last but not least, observable fissures or foundation wear may also hint at water line issues. Identifying these indicators promptly can help mitigate extensive damage and costly repairs down the line, underscoring the value of routine monitoring and maintenance.

Initial Assessment Steps
An efficient water line repair starts with a detailed initial assessment, vital for determining the source and extent of the problem. Professionals typically commence by carrying out a visual inspection of the property, searching for signs of water damage, wet spots, or unusual water pressure levels. They may also check for any visible leaks or corrosion along the water lines. Employing specialized equipment, such as moisture meters and video cameras, technicians can more thoroughly examine underground or hidden pipes. Collecting this information allows them to establish whether the issue is a minor leak or a substantial break. Accurate assessment ensures that subsequent repair strategies are tailored to the specific problem, ultimately leading to a more effective and efficient resolution.
Overview of Repair Techniques
After the initial assessment is complete, technicians use various repair methods adapted to the specific concern at hand. For minor leaks, sealants and epoxy compounds may be employed, successfully sealing cracks without major disruption. In cases of significant damage, pipe replacement becomes necessary; this involves uncovering the affected area and installing new piping. Trenchless techniques provides a less invasive solution, permitting repairs without major digging. Additionally, experts may use video inspection tools to guarantee the integrity of repairs and identify potential future concerns. Each approach is chosen based on factors such as the severity of the damage and the location of the water line, ensuring an efficient and lasting solution for both residential and commercial properties.

Top Tips for Water Line Care
While water lines are often taken for granted, periodic maintenance is vital for guaranteeing their longevity and maximum performance. Residents and business operators should perform routine inspections to recognize signs of wear or potential leaks. Ensuring the area around water lines clear of debris will help prevent physical damage and provide easier access during inspections. It is also prudent to monitor water pressure; remarkably high or low pressure can suggest underlying issues that require attention. Routinely flushing the lines can help clear out sediment buildup, which may impact water quality and flow. In addition, scheduling professional maintenance at least once a year presents an opportunity for comprehensive checks and repairs. By following these best practices, individuals can significantly reduce the risk of costly repairs and ensure their water systems operate efficiently. Adequate maintenance not only lengthens the life of the water lines but also promotes a safe and healthy environment.

What Are the Expenses Related to Water Line Repairs?
The prices linked to water line repairs usually range from $500 to $3,000, based on factors including the extent of damage, location, and materials used. Additional fees may apply for permits and labor.

Which Materials Are Utilized for Water Line Repairs?
Water line repairs typically utilize materials including PVC, copper, or PEX piping, alongside connectors, fittings, and sealants. These materials guarantee lasting quality and reliability, meeting numerous plumbing needs while upholding system integrity over time.
